An Electrochemical Cholesteric Liquid Crystalline Device for Quick and Low-Voltage Color Modulation
Published on: February 27, 2019
Wan-Li He1, Ya-Qian Zhang1, Wen-Tuo Hu1
1School of Materials Science and Engineering, University of Science and Technology Beijing, Beijing 100083, China.
Researchers developed new cholesteric liquid crystal (CLC) composites using ionic chiral ferrocene derivatives. These materials enable electrically tunable reflective bands, overcoming limitations of traditional CLCs in optical devices.
